
Java Tea: Benefits for Middle-Aged Men’s Health
Java Tea, scientifically known as Orthosiphon stamineus or Cat’s Whiskers, is a herbal remedy widely recognized for its numerous health benefits. This plant, native to Southeast Asia, has been traditionally used in herbal medicine to support kidney function, urinary tract health, and overall wellness. As men reach middle age, they often face specific health concerns such as prostate health, metabolic changes, and cardiovascular issues. Java Tea presents a natural solution to some of these concerns, making it a valuable addition to a health-conscious lifestyle.

How to Consume Java Tea
1. Traditional Tea Preparation
The most common way to consume Java Tea is by brewing it as a herbal tea. To prepare:
- Boil 1-2 teaspoons of dried Java Tea leaves in 1 cup of water.
- Let it steep for 10-15 minutes.
- Strain and drink warm or chilled.
- Consume 1-2 cups daily for optimal benefits.

Potential Side Effects and Precautions
While Java Tea is generally safe for consumption, excessive intake may lead to dehydration due to its diuretic properties. Men with existing kidney or liver conditions should consult a healthcare provider before incorporating Java Tea into their routine. Additionally, those on medication for blood pressure or diabetes should monitor their intake to avoid interactions.
